// DATE 270915 // NOHALT * *** RUN MAINT. * // LOAD $MAINT,F1 // RUN // COPY FROM-READER,TO-F1,RETAIN-R,LIBRARY-S,NAME-@WKA MACRO @WKA &EXP-N .* .* 5703-XM1 GENERAL EQUATES. .* TEXT PRINT OFF AIF (&EXP EQ 'Y').ON PRINT ON REQUESTED ? AIF (&EXP EQ 'N').OFF PRINT OFF REQUESTED ? .ERR MNOTE 00,'INVALID MACRO OPTION SPECIFIED.' AGO .MEND .ON ANOP PRINT ON .OFF ANOP TITLE '@WKAEQ - SYSTEM WORK AREA ADDRESSES' ********************************************************************** * THIS EQUATE MODULE PROVIDES THE FIXED PHYSICAL DISK * * ADDRESSES OF PGM'S AND WA'S IN THE SYSTEM WORK AREA. * ********************************************************************** * *** SELECTED SYSTEM PROGRAMS AND BAD LINE * #@WAR1 EQU X'0400' DADDR OF SELECTED PGM AREA #@WAF1 EQU X'0401' DADDR OF SELECTED PGM AREA #@BOVL EQU X'0400' PHYSICAL DADDR OF #BOVLY #@@BOV EQU 24 SECTOR COUNT OF #BOVLY #@SFSY EQU X'0480' PHYSICAL DADDR OF #SFSYN #@@SFS EQU 17 SECTOR COUNT OF #SFSYN #@GUFU EQU X'0401' PHYSICAL DADDR OF #GUFUD #@@GUF EQU 16 SECTOR COUNT OF #GUFUD #@SDSY EQU X'04AD' PHYSICAL DADDR OF #SDSYN #@@SDS EQU 4 SECTOR COUNT OF #SDSYN #@ERRP EQU X'0441' PHYSICAL DADDR OF #ERRPG #@@ERR EQU 3 SECTOR COUNT OF #ERRPG #@LDSV EQU X'044D' PHYS DADDR OF #LOADR SAVE AREA #@@LDS EQU 2 SECTOR COUNT OF #LOADR SA #@#BAD EQU X'0455' PHYSICAL DADDR OF THE BAD LINE #@@#BA EQU 1 SECTOR COUNT OF ##BADL #@ECMA EQU X'0481' PHYSICAL DADDR OF #ECMAN #@@ECM EQU 6 SECTOR COUNT OF #ECMAN #@SFLO EQU X'0499' PHYSICAL DADDR OF SFLOAD #@@SFL EQU 5 SECTOR COUNT OF SFLOAD #@SFFI EQU X'04BD' PHYSICAL DADDR OF SFFIND #@@SFF EQU 8 SECTOR COUNT OF SFFIND #@#IO1 EQU X'0459' PHYSICAL DADDR OF 1ST I/O SECTOR #@#IO2 EQU X'045D' PHYSICAL DADDR OF 2ST I/O SECTOR #@@#SC EQU 2 SECTOR COUNT OF I/O SECTOR #@@#08 EQU 8 NO. ENTRIES IN 1ST I/O SECTOR #@@#04 EQU 4 NO. ENTRIES IN 2ND I/O SECTOR #@@#IO EQU 1 SECTOR COUNT OF I/O SECTOR #@SFOV EQU X'04C4' PHYSICAL DADDR OF #SFOVR #@@SFO EQU 5 SECTOR COUNT OF #SFOVR * *** WORK FILE ADDRESSES * #@#WFT EQU X'0500' PHYSICAL DADDR 1ST SCTR OF FIT #@@#WF EQU 3 SCTR COUNT OF FIT #@#WDB EQU X'050C' PHYSICAL DADDR OF 1ST DATA BLOCK #@@#WD EQU 189 SCTR COUNT OF DATA BLOCKS * *** VIRTUAL MEMORY ADDRESSES * #@#VFP EQU X'0700' PHYSICAL DADDR FIRST PAGE OF VM #@VTRL EQU X'0708' DADDR OF SAVED 'TRACE' VAR.LIST #@@VTR EQU 1 SCTR COUNT SAVED 'TRACE' VAR.LIST #@#VLP EQU X'093D' PHYSICAL DADDR LAST PAGE OF VM #@@#VM EQU 256 SCTR COUNT OF VIRTUAL MEMORY * *** TEMPORARELY WORK AREA ADDRESSES * #@#TFS EQU X'0941' PHYSICAL DADDR 1ST SCTR TEMP WK AREA #@@#TW EQU 32 SCTR COUNT OF TEMP WORKAREA #@#TAT EQU X'0941' PHYSICAL DADDR STMT ADDR TABLE #@@#TA EQU 16 SCTR COUNT OF STMT ADDR TABLE #@#TSY EQU X'0941' PHYSICAL DADDR SYMBOL TBL SAVE AREA #@@#TS EQU 5 SCTR COUNT OF SYMBOL TBL SAVE AREA #@#TBA EQU X'09A1' PHYSICAL DADDR BRANCH ADDR TABLE #@@#TB EQU 16 SCTR COUNT OF BRANCH ADDR TABLE #@VSFI EQU X'09A1' PHYSICAL DADDR VSFINT #@@VSF EQU 16 SCTR COUNT OF VSFINT #@@VSL EQU 15 SCTR COUNT OF VSFLOA * END OF WORK AREA EQUATES .* END OF MACRO; RESTORE PRINT ON. .MEND ANOP PRINT ON MEND // CEND // END * // READER CONSOLE